Hi,
I have a problem with if else and loop. Lets say I have an array zz double.The value of zz is 2,10,11,23,26,30,37,38,48,53,63,65,66,70,79 and 80. For each element will have its own calculation in the if else statement. I've tried to do if else like this
for Z = 1:numel(zz)
if zz==1;
% if true,do calculation 1
elseif zz==2;
% if true,do calculation 2
and so on.
When I run,it should output result for calculation 2 because the first element in the array is equal to 2. But the coding seems doesn't go through the if else coding. Any help is really appreciated. Thanks.

You have forgotten to index your zz entries in the for-loop. It should read:
for Z = 1:numel(zz)
if zz(Z)==1;
% if true,do calculation 1
elseif zz(Z)==2;
% if true,do calculation 2
Otherwise you are placing an impossible condition on each 'if' or 'elseif'. None of them could ever be true.
